Sapphire Tube length 50.8 mm Pressure Resistant Customized Size Single Crystal Al2O3


Our Single Crystal Al₂O₃ Pressure Resistant Sapphire Tubes are engineered for extreme environments requiring high pressure resistance, optical clarity, and chemical inertness. Available in 2-inch (50.8mm) standard diameter with customizable lengths and wall thicknesses, these tubes are manufactured using premium-grade α-Al₂O₃ crystals through the Kyropoulos (KY) or Edge-defined Film-fed Growth (EFG) methods. With a burst pressure rating up to 10,000 psi (depending on wall thickness) and thermal stability from -200°C to 1,800°C, they are ideal for high-pressure viewports, semiconductor processing, and defense applications.
Key advantages over quartz or polycrystalline alumina:
✔ 3× higher mechanical strength (Flexural strength: 600-800 MPa)
✔ Superior thermal shock resistance (ΔT >500°C)
✔ Zero outgassing in vacuum/UHV environments
✔ Custom optical polishing (Ra <0.02μm) for laser-grade transparency

Key Features of Sapphire Tubes


1.Sapphire Tube Pressure Resistance

  • Burst pressure: 5,000–10,000 psi (varies by WT)
  • Safe working pressure: 30–50% of burst pressure
  • Hydrostatic tested: Each tube certified to 1.5× working pressure

2.Sapphire Tube Material Excellence

  • Single crystal α-Al₂O: C-axis (0001) orientation standard
  • Purity: >99.995% (4N5) with <10 defects/cm²
  • Density: 3.98 g/cm³

3. Sapphire Tube Thermal Performance

  • Max temperature: 1,800°C (inert), 1,200°C (oxidizing)
  • Thermal conductivity: 35 W/m·K @25°C
  • CTE: 5.3×10⁻⁶/°C (25–500°C)

4. Sapphire Tube Optical Clarity

  • Transmission: >85% (200–5,500 nm)
  • Surface finish options:
    • Standard polish: Ra <0.02μm
    • Laser-grade polish: Ra <0.005μm

5. Customization

  • Diameter: 2" standard (50.8mm), other sizes 0.5–8"
  • Wall thickness: 0.04–1.0" (1–25mm)
  • Length: Up to 60" (1,500mm)
  • Coatings: AR/HR/DLC available

Applications of Sapphire Tubes


1. High-Pressure Systems

  • Oil/gas downhole sensors: Withstands >5,000 psi at 300°C
  • Supercritical fluid reactors: Corrosion-resistant to CO₂/H₂S

2. Semiconductor & Vacuum

  • Plasma etcher liners: Erosion-resistant for SiC/GaN processing
  • MBE/UHV viewports: Zero outgassing at 10⁻¹⁰ Torr

3. Defense & Aerospace

  • Missile dome prototypes: Hypervelocity impact resistant
  • Deep-sea ROV lights: 10,000m pressure rating (1,100 atm)

4. Scientific Research

  • Diamond anvil cell components: For >1M atm experiments
  • Fusion reactor diagnostics: Neutron radiation tolerant

5. Industrial Process

  • High-pressure burner tubes: For 1,500°C combustion
  • Chemical injection probes: Resists HF/H₃PO₄

Specifications

Category

Parameter

Specification

Dimensions Inner Diameter (ID) 2.00" ±0.002" (50.8mm)
Wall Thickness (WT) 0.04–0.40" (1–10mm)
Length (L) 1–60" (25–1,500mm)
Mechanical Burst Pressure 5,000–10,000 psi
Flexural Strength 600–800 MPa
Hardness 2,000 HV (Mohs 9)
Thermal Max Temp (Inert) 1,800°C
Thermal Shock ΔT >500°C
Optical Transmission >85% (200–5,500nm)
Surface Roughness Ra <0.02μm (standard)
Electrical Resistivity >10¹⁴ Ω·cm



FAQ

Q1: How does wall thickness affect pressure rating?

  • 0.1" WT: ~3,000 psi working pressure
  • 0.25" WT: ~7,500 psi working pressure
  • 0.4" WT: ~10,000 psi burst pressure

Q3: How does sapphire compare to quartz for pressure?

Property

Sapphire (2"x0.25")

Fused Quartz

Burst Pressure 7,500 psi 1,500 psi
Max Temp 1,800°C 1,100°C
Cost $$$ $


Q4: Can sapphire tubes be repaired if cracked?
No – Single crystal sapphire cannot be welded/repaired.
